The onboarding problem in ecommerce and ERP partner ecosystems
OEM ERP partnerships in ecommerce frequently involve multiple stakeholders: the ERP vendor, the ecommerce platform, the implementation partner, the merchant or enterprise customer, and often third-party logistics or payment systems. Each stakeholder introduces process dependencies, data quality issues, and approval cycles. Without an enterprise automation platform to coordinate these interactions, onboarding becomes dependent on spreadsheets, email approvals, disconnected ticketing systems, and tribal knowledge held by senior consultants.
This creates several business problems. First, project-only revenue dominates the engagement because teams are paid to solve onboarding complexity manually. Second, customer experience becomes inconsistent because each implementation follows a different path. Third, the partner struggles to create a scalable managed AI services model because there is no standardized operational layer to monitor workflows, exceptions, and service performance after launch.
- Manual onboarding increases delivery cost, extends time to value, and reduces consultant utilization.
- Disconnected workflows across ERP, ecommerce, CRM, and support systems create avoidable implementation bottlenecks.
- Lack of operational intelligence limits visibility into onboarding status, exception rates, and customer readiness.
- Weak governance exposes partners to compliance, data handling, and change management risks.
- Project-centric delivery models make it difficult to build recurring automation revenue and long-term account expansion.

Workflow automation recommendations for ecommerce OEM ERP onboarding
The most effective onboarding programs focus on repeatable workflow layers rather than isolated integrations. Partners should design onboarding around process orchestration across ERP, ecommerce, CRM, support, and analytics systems. This is where an AI automation platform becomes more valuable than a narrow connector strategy. Connectors move data. Workflow orchestration manages business outcomes.
In practice, onboarding workflows should include automated intake, role-based task assignment, master data validation, catalog and pricing synchronization, tax and compliance checks, test order simulation, exception management, and go-live readiness scoring. When these workflows are instrumented through an operational intelligence platform, partners gain visibility into where onboarding slows down, which customer segments require more intervention, and which implementation patterns produce the best margin.
High-value automation opportunities partners can package
- Automated partner and customer intake workflows that collect technical, commercial, and compliance requirements in a governed sequence.
- AI-assisted data mapping for product catalogs, customer records, pricing tiers, and inventory structures between ecommerce and ERP systems.
- Workflow orchestration for approval chains involving finance, operations, IT, and external implementation stakeholders.
- Automated testing and exception routing for order flows, tax calculations, shipping rules, and payment reconciliation.
- Post-go-live monitoring services that detect synchronization failures, latency issues, and process anomalies before they affect customer operations.

Governance, compliance, and scalability recommendations
As onboarding becomes more automated, governance must become more deliberate. Partners should define workflow ownership, approval policies, audit trails, exception thresholds, and data handling standards before scaling automation across accounts. In regulated industries or cross-border ecommerce environments, governance should also address tax logic changes, customer data residency, access controls, and retention policies.
A managed AI services model is only sustainable when governance is embedded into the platform architecture. That means role-based access, environment separation, workflow version control, observability, and policy-driven escalation. It also means documenting where AI is used for recommendations, classification, or anomaly detection versus where deterministic workflow rules remain the system of control. This distinction is essential for compliance credibility and enterprise trust.
Scalability should be evaluated at three levels: technical scalability, operational scalability, and commercial scalability. Technical scalability requires cloud-native infrastructure, resilient integrations, and support for unlimited users without forcing per-seat economics that penalize adoption. Operational scalability requires reusable templates, centralized monitoring, and governed change management. Commercial scalability requires infrastructure-based pricing that allows partners to maintain margin while expanding usage across customer accounts.
